Srinagar: Thousands of people from different areas of Sopore reached Brath Kalan village to attend last rites of Hizb militant Nayeem Ahmad Najar who was killed in a gunfight with government forces on Monday.

Najar was killed along with Hizb divisional commander Pervaiz Ahmad Wani of Galoora Handwara in a brief gunfight with forces in Shankergund area of Sopore.

Reports said that thousands of people marched towards Brath Kalan amid pro-freedom sloganeering where they participated in the funeral prayers of Najar.

Women from Najarโ€™s family showered his body with candies while few militants offered a gun salute.
